Overview
Royal Mail is driving a major value creation and cost transformation programme. This senior, embedded delivery role is based within the Value Creation Office (VCO) and will be accountable for delivering value across a defined cluster of corporate and operational functions, partnering directly with Executive Board sponsors and senior leaders.
The opportunity
As the Value Creation Delivery Lead, you will be the VCO's single point of accountability for your function cluster. You will own senior relationships, challenge constructively, improve delivery discipline, and ensure value commitments convert into measurable results. Your influence will shape priorities, resolve complexity and inform decisions at Executive and Board level.
What you'll be doing
- Own relationships with Executive Board leads and senior stakeholders, acting as a trusted partner and confident challenger.
- Drive delivery of complex, multi‑workstream initiatives, ensuring credible plans, strong governance and real value outcomes.
- Coach and challenge initiative leads to raise plan quality, accountability and execution pace.
- Identify and actively manage interdependencies, risks and blockers, escalating decisively when required.
- Provide targeted, hands‑on SWAT support to high‑value or at‑risk initiatives to keep delivery on track.
- Track, validate and assure financial value in close partnership with Finance, ensuring benefits are accurately baselined and realised.
- Direct and oversee third‑party consultants and Royal Mail resources deployed within your portfolio.
- Produce clear, robust reporting for SteerCo and programme governance forums.
What we're looking for
- A strong track record in strategy consulting, transformation or complex programme delivery (Manager level or equivalent).
- Experience operating simultaneously across multiple business functions and senior stakeholder groups.
- Sharp commercial judgement and the ability to focus teams on what truly drives value.
- Confidence, credibility and gravitas at Executive level.
- Excellent structuring, problem‑solving and communication skills.
- Experience in cost transformation, value creation or operational improvement programmes.
- Experience working alongside consulting firms on large‑scale transformations (desirable).
- A degree from a leading university is required; an MBA or postgraduate qualification is advantageous but not essential.
